DESCRIPTION:Founded in 1999\, Phase Technologies developed Phase Perfect® 
 digital phase converters\, the first major advance of phase conversion tec
 hnology in decades. Recognized as the world’s leading manufacturer of ph
 ase converter technologies\, the company expanded its product offerings to
  include variable frequency drives (VFD). Specializing in VFD with Active 
 Front End technology\, Phase Technologies produces the only low harmonic\,
  fully regenerative\, phase-converting VFD that complies with IEEE 519\, t
 he international standard for allowable harmonic levels on utility mains. 
 The company has an extensive product line-up of low harmonic\, fully regen
 erative drives in both three-phase and phase-converting models. Phase Tech
 nologies relies on a team of in-house power electronics and mechanical des
 ign engineers to develop innovative products\, encompassing all aspects of
  hardware and firmware design. All products are manufactured at our facili
 ties in the USA under exacting quality standards. In-house processes inclu
 de printed circuit board population and custom magnetics fabrication. The 
 company operates a certified UL 508A panel shop to integrate our drives in
 to rugged outdoor panels with custom options for applications including ir
 rigation\, oil and gas production and general industrial control. Phase Te
 chnologies was founded by one of the SDSMT alumni\, Dr. Larry G. Meiners a
 nd his associates. Dr. Meiners was Professor in Electrical Engineering and
  Physics departments at SDSMT. This presentation provides unique opportuni
